Default Lansu controller power adapter?

On the Lansu Tx for the RS10, there's a power port on the back, behind the handle. I can't find anything online or in the manual saying what it is used for or what the power requirements are. Anyone know if it is a plug that allows you to use it with an AC adapter, or if it will charge your batteries in the Tx? It isn't even referenced in the user manual.

Its so you can charge a controller pack. Most JR, Spectrum and other controller chargers will work. Most local hobby shops can get you the pack and charger.
